@ -29,8 +29,13 @@ The In Core Memory test calculates a checksum (HMAC-SHA256) of the wolfCrypt
FIPS library code and constant data and compares it with a known value in
the code.
The Randomized Base Address setting needs to be disabled on all builds as the
feature throws off the in-core memory calculation causing the test to fail.
The following wolfCrypt FIPS project linker settings are required for the DLL Win32 configuration:
1) The [Randomized Base Address setting (ASLR)](https://learn.microsoft.com/en-us/cpp/build/reference/dynamicbase-use-address-space-layout-randomization?view=msvc-170)
needs to be disabled on all builds as the feature throws off the in-core memory calculation causing the test to fail.
2) The [Incremental Link](https://learn.microsoft.com/en-us/cpp/build/reference/incremental-link-incrementally?view=msvc-170)
option need turned off so function pointers go to actual code, not a jump instruction.
3) The [FixedBaseAddress](https://learn.microsoft.com/en-us/cpp/build/reference/fixed-fixed-base-address?view=msvc-170)
option to YES, which disables the support for ASLR.
